#d4d573 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d4d573 is composed of 83.1% red, 83.5% green and 45.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 46%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 60.6 degrees, a saturation of 53.8% and a lightness of 64.3%. #d4d573 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ffe6 with #a9ab00. Closest websafe color is: #cccc66.

#d4d573 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d4d573 has RGB values of R:212, G:213, B:115 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0, Y:0.46,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 13948275.
